P. S. Gumawar Kothi: A Detailed Profile of a Bihar Primary School

P. S. Gumawar Kothi, a government-run primary school in the rural heart of Bihar, stands as a testament to the dedication to education in underserved communities. Established in 1965, this co-educational institution plays a vital role in providing basic education to children in the Daraulli block of Siwan district. The school, managed by the Department of Education, offers classes from 1st to 5th standard, imparting knowledge and fostering growth in young minds.

Instruction is primarily delivered in Hindi, ensuring accessibility for the local children. The school boasts a team of four dedicated teachers—three male and one female—who strive to create a nurturing learning environment. The school building, while government-provided, features a pucca but broken wall, highlighting the need for infrastructural improvements. Despite the challenges, the school houses seven classrooms, each in good condition and suitable for teaching.

A key feature of P. S. Gumawar Kothi is its library, stocked with 80 books, offering students valuable access to literature. While lacking a playground, the school provides essential facilities such as hand pumps for drinking water and separate functional toilets for boys and girls. Importantly, the school has ramps for disabled children, ensuring inclusivity and accessibility for all students. The school's commitment to students’ well-being extends to the provision of midday meals, prepared on the school premises.

The school's location in a rural area presents certain challenges, notably the absence of electricity and computer-aided learning facilities.
